What is keeping Lidl, Europe’s preeminent grocery chain, from gaining similar success in the U.S?

Upon entry to the U.S. market in 2017, Lidl US aspired to open 1,000 stores in its first years. But the company was unable to attract US consumers. By 2024, Lidl had managed to open fewer than 200 stores, capturing less than 1% of the market. To right the expansion effort in 2023, Joel Rampoldt became Lidl US’s fourth president. In 2024, he faced critical issues in the selection of store locations, assortment, customer relationship management, and effectively communicating Lidl US’s value proposition in a crowded and competitive market.
